Size and Dimensions
Selecting the right size and dimensions for a small space recliner is essential for maximizing comfort and functionality in your home. Start by measuring your available area to guarantee the chair fits comfortably without blocking pathways or other furniture. Look for compact recliners, typically under 40 inches tall and around 30 inches wide, to enhance space efficiency. Keep in mind the chair’s footprint when fully reclined, as some models need more room, affecting your layout. Evaluate the seat depth and height; a width of 21 to 22 inches is ideal for limited seating areas. Finally, opt for designs that offer multiple reclining positions, allowing you to enjoy versatility while maintaining a compact profile.
Reclining Mechanism Types
Choosing the right reclining mechanism can greatly impact your comfort and convenience in a small space. You’ll find options like manual recliners, which use a lever or pull handle, and power recliners that adjust effortlessly with an electric motor. Consider recliners that offer multiple reclining angles, typically ranging from 90° to 180°, so you can find your ideal position for reading, watching TV, or napping. Look for models with a dual foot extension design for personalized relaxation. A 360-degree swivel function can also enhance versatility, letting you rotate your seating without standing up. If you enjoy soothing motions, some recliners include a gentle rocking feature, perfect for reducing stress and promoting relaxation in tight quarters.
Material and Durability
While it might be tempting to focus solely on style when picking a small space recliner, the materials and durability play an essential role in your overall satisfaction. Opt for high-quality PU leather or breathable fabrics that not only offer comfort but are also easy to clean and maintain. Look for sturdy hardwood or metal frames to guarantee your recliner supports heavier weight capacities and lasts over time. High-density foam or sponge padding is ideal, as it retains shape and provides lasting support. Choose upholstery that resists pilling and wear, combining aesthetics with functionality. Finally, consider options that are easy to wipe clean and resistant to spills and dust, enhancing practicality for your compact living space.

Weight Capacity Considerations
After you’ve set up your small space recliner, it’s important to assess its weight capacity. Most recliners range from 265 to 350 pounds, so consider who will be using it. A higher weight capacity often means a sturdier frame and better materials, which enhance durability and stability. Remember, it’s not just about the maximum weight; how that weight is distributed across the chair matters too for safety and comfort during use. Look for recliners with reinforced structures designed to support heavier weights without sacrificing style or comfort. Assessing the weight capacity relative to your needs guarantees your recliner remains functional and safe for regular use in your small space.
